Frequently Asked Questions

What salary ranges can I expect by seniority level?
Entry‑level B.Sc. engineers typically earn $50,000–$70,000 annually. Mid‑level roles, with 3–5 years of experience, command $70,000–$100,000, while senior engineers or technical leads with 7+ years can reach $100,000–$140,000, especially in high‑growth fields like additive manufacturing or electric vehicle design.
What specific skills and certifications are most valuable?
Key skills include CAD (SolidWorks, CATIA), simulation (ANSYS, Simulink), PLC programming (CODESYS, Siemens TIA Portal), and data analysis (Python, MATLAB). Certifications such as Professional Engineer (PE), Project Management Professional (PMP), Six Sigma Green/Black Belt, and cloud‑engineering certificates (AWS Certified Solutions Architect) boost credibility and salary potential.
Can B.Sc. Engineering roles be performed remotely?
Yes—design, simulation, and software development positions are largely remote‑friendly, especially when using cloud‑based CAD and simulation tools. However, roles that require field testing, plant maintenance, or on‑site project management may demand partial onsite presence.
What career progression paths are available?
Typical trajectories include Junior Engineer → Senior Engineer → Technical Lead → Engineering Manager or Project Manager. Alternatively, engineers can specialize in emerging areas such as additive manufacturing, smart grid systems, or AI‑driven design, leading to roles like Lead Additive Manufacturing Engineer or AI Systems Architect.
What industry trends are shaping B.Sc. Engineering jobs?
Current trends include Industry 4.0 integration, digital twins for predictive maintenance, widespread adoption of additive manufacturing, and a push toward sustainable, low‑carbon products. Engineers who master IoT, cloud simulation, and green‑energy technologies are positioned for the highest growth and compensation.
